First - this comment is not directed at Glenn. Since I moderate this forum, I feel that I need to set the record as straight as possible, with my limited knowledge. Glenn, I know of your car. You can put any euro option on it that you wish - right down to the mud flaps. It's a Factory car, so anything goes. It's also a euro, like James Smith's & others on this forum. Those lights were readily available, and legal, in Europe. As I recollect, they were illegal in the US at the time. But, and this is just me, if I were judging a US 914 in a concours, unless they could provide proof of originality for the rear fog (via COA or BOS), they'd get gigged for non-original equipment. As a judge, I make no distinction between local, regional, or national events. Unless you can prove that it's supposed to be on a US 914, you get gigged. Not necessarily hard, but all points matter. US 914 with the side markers filled in - gig. Doesn't matter if you've swithed all the lights. In fact, if you have - larger gigs. This is an originality forum. Sorry if I p_iss off others, but that's what it is. Still we like to hear from the other-side-of-the-pond cars. Pat |
